Output 3065b724f68705541042320474df8b1fd2ccb52377c25b71af04b74f1beeaf1a:83

value
115972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c0f6da2f8e594a7df428d0ba7aecfe5ba10cb7d OP_EQUAL
address
3Mkb4ini26hV7wndgmqWiYafRkimXzwJHQ
transaction
3065b724f68705541042320474df8b1fd2ccb52377c25b71af04b74f1beeaf1a
confirmations
235528
spent
true